TPO Roofing, or Thermoplastic Polyolefin Roofing, is a durable and energy-efficient single-ply membrane system. It's commonly used in commercial construction due to its reflective properties, which reduce cooling costs and enhance environmental sustainability. TPO provides a robust defense against UV radiation, chemicals, and other environmental factors, making it a popular choice in the industry.

What Services Do TPO Roofing Provide In Honolulu, Hawaii?

TPO roofing services typically center on inspection, leak isolation, heat-welded repairs, seam re-welding, flashing/detail corrections, maintenance planning, restoration feasibility, replacement triggers, storm response, and coating-based life extension, with scope determined by seam condition, penetration details, drainage performance, and insulation moisture risk.

  • TPO Roof Inspection: Seam checks, puncture scans, drainage review, attachment assessment
  • TPO Leak Detection: Isolate active entry points at penetrations, curbs, and transitions
  • TPO Roof Repair: Heat-welded patching, seam reinforcement, detail repairs, walkway repairs
  • TPO Seam Re-Welding: Restore weld strength at fatigued or separating seams
  • TPO Flashing and Detail Work: Equipment curbs, pipe boots, parapets, term bars, edge metal interfaces
  • TPO Maintenance Programs: Scheduled cleanings, drain clearing, weld touch-ups, condition reporting
  • TPO Roof Restoration: Recover options where suitable, insulation and substrate dependent
  • TPO Roof Replacement: Membrane fatigue, widespread leaks, or insulation saturation triggers
  • TPO Storm and Wind Damage Repair: Uplift investigation, perimeter securement, emergency dry-in
  • TPO Roof Coating Systems: Coating options to extend membrane service life when appropriate

A TPO Roofing Contractor will confirm seam weld integrity, flashing performance, drainage function, and insulation moisture status before selecting the correct path—targeted repair, scheduled maintenance, restoration/coating where compatible, or replacement when end-of-life conditions are verified.

Is TPO Roofing more energy-efficient in Honolulu, Hawaii's climate than modified bitumen?

Yes. TPO Roofing is more energy-efficient in Honolulu, Hawaii's climate than modified bitumen. The high solar reflectivity of TPO reduces heat absorption, which is beneficial given the intense sunlight found in the region. This contrast with modified bitumen helps lower cooling costs, adding an energy-saving advantage to buildings equipped with TPO systems.

How Much Does TPO Roofing Cost in Honolulu, Hawaii?

TPO roofing cost in Honolulu, Hawaii is primarily determined by roof size, insulation requirements, attachment method, detail complexity, and tear-off scope. Most pricing is calculated per square foot after an on-site inspection confirms the roof assembly condition and the number of penetrations, edges, and drains.

  • TPO Roof Repair Cost: Depends on leak location, seam condition, and access. Small heat-welded repairs are typically priced per repair area, while complex detail repairs are scoped individually.
  • TPO Roof Replacement Cost: Driven by tear-off requirements, insulation thickness, attachment system (mechanically fastened vs fully adhered), and flashing/drainage detailing.
  • TPO Roof Coating Cost: Only applicable when the membrane and seams are in suitable condition. Pricing depends on preparation, seam reinforcement, and coating type.
  • TPO Maintenance Cost: Usually based on roof size and visit frequency, including drain clearing, seam checks, and minor defect correction.

The fastest way to get an accurate number is a roof inspection that confirms membrane condition, moisture intrusion, insulation saturation, and detailing requirements.

Why this works on TPO roofs

System-level cause and effect:

  1. Heat-welded seam continuity → resists thermal cycling → seams do not separate into leak paths
  2. Flashing integrity at penetrations → seals equipment zones → water does not enter the assembly
  3. Attachment stability → resists uplift and movement → membrane does not shift or fatigue
  4. Drainage performance → evacuates water → ponding does not stress seams or insulation
  5. Moisture control in the assembly → prevents saturation → thermal resistance and interior protection remain stable
